Retail chain store area supervisor vs sales manager

The differences between retail chain store area supervisors and sales managers can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. It typically takes 6-8 years to become both a retail chain store area supervisor and a sales manager. Additionally, a sales manager has an average salary of $73,952, which is higher than the $71,827 average annual salary of a retail chain store area supervisor.

The top three skills for a retail chain store area supervisor include customer service, bank deposits and . The most important skills for a sales manager are product knowledge, customer satisfaction, and sales performance.
